1. Standard Bunk Beds
Basic bunk beds consist of 2 beds stacked on top of each other. They are generally easy in style and extremely practical.
2. Loft Beds
Loft beds raise the sleeping area while leaving the space underneath open for other uses, like a desk or play location. This alternative is outstanding for studios or children's spaces.
3. L-Shaped Bunk Beds
L-shaped bunk beds include two beds set up perpendicularly to each other. This style can frequently consist of extra functions such as integrated racks or a staircase.
4. Twin-over-Full Bunk Beds
This design includes a twin bed on the top and a fuller-sized bed on the bottom, appealing to both kids and teenagers.
5. Bunk Beds with Trundle
These bunk beds feature an additional bed that can be pulled out from underneath the bottom bunk, perfect for sleepovers.
6. Customized Bunk Beds
Numerous makers use custom-made styles to fit special measurements or themes, making them best for particular space designs.
Considerations When Purchasing a Bunk Bed
While bunk beds provide many benefits, numerous aspects must be evaluated before buying. Here are some essential factors to consider:
Safety Standards: Ensure the bunk bed satisfies safety requirements set by regulatory bodies, including guardrails and strong building.Product Quality: Choose products that are long lasting and safe, such as solid wood or top quality metal.Space Size and Dimensions: Measure the space and consider ceiling height to ensure the bunk bed fits conveniently.Weight Capacity: Check the weight limit for the beds to prevent structural issues later on.Style and Aesthetics: Consider the space's design and select a bunk bed that matches existing furniture.Reduce of Access: Children ought to be able to climb up safely to the leading bunk. Bunk beds can be safe for young kids if they fulfill safety standards and consist of features like guardrails. It's essential to supervise kids on the leading bunk.
Q2: How can I optimize storage with a bunk bed?
Consider bunk beds with built-in drawers or storage shelves beneath the bottom bed, or utilize the space beneath the bed for bins or boxes.
Q3: What is the optimum allowable weight for bunk beds?
The majority of twin bunk beds can accommodate around 200-250 pounds per bed. Constantly consult the manufacturer for particular weight limitations.
Q4: Can I separate a bunk bed into two single beds?
Lots of bunk beds are designed to be converted into two separate beds, however it's important to confirm this option with the producer.
Q5: What devices can boost the functionality of a bunk bed?
Depending on the model, devices like mattresses, linens, storage options, and security rails can enhance the performance and convenience of bunk beds.
